If you are coming up Rte 47, stop in Quilt in Joy in Huntley or Judy's Quilt in Sew in Hampshire. Quilt in Joy specializes in brights and batiks. Judy's is a nice general shop. Both carry different stock than the shop at Millie's. There are two small shops in Woodstock. Sewing Concepts specializes in hoop embroidery quilting. If you are going to Milwaukee, then there is a shop in Waukesha.
